Man accused of attempted rape at Hampstead cinema appears in court

A man accused of attempting to rape a woman at a Hampstead cinema has appeared in court.

Cyrille Moreau, 67, is accused of attempting to have sex without consent with a woman in her 30s at the Vue cinema on Finchley Road.

He has been charged with attempted rape over the alleged incident, which happened at around 3.45pm on June 11.

Moreau, of Ainger Road in Primrose Hill, North London, was held in custody by police after being charged.

He appeared at Highbury Corner magistrates court on Wednesday.

Police said Moreau was arrested at 5.30pm on Monday in connection with the incident, following a media appeal.

The accused man did not enter a plea to the charge of attempted rape during his first court appearance.

According to the charge, it is alleged he “intentionally attempted to penetrate the vagina of a woman with your penis, when she did not consent and you did not reasonably believe that she was consenting.”

Moreau is next due in the dock on July 17 at Wood Green crown court.
